BE AGGRESSIVE 'Cheers' Its Way Into New Village Arts On 4/4

By:

BE AGGRESSIVE runs APRIL 4 - 26. Written by Annie Weisman and directed By Kristianne Kurner.

A hilarious, all-too-true look at contemporary adolescence, Be Aggressive tells the story of a high school cheerleader from San Diego searching for meaning in her life. A satirical look at the suburban dream found and lost, this play follows Laura and her best friend Leslie as they journey across the country in search of themselves and the perfect standing back tuck, while their parents try to come to terms with the real challenges of life in sunny Southern California.
